HIGH DEFINITION MULTI-CAMERA On March 26th I directed our first HDCAM multi-camera job using six Sony HDW-F900 camcorders. It was a great experience that brought to light several things that you should consider if you do a similar job. First, some details. We were shooting two performances by stand up comedian Omid Djalili at the London Palladium. The production company that hired us has used Procam before to shoot performances by comedian Ross Noble and other comic acts. The end use will be for a DVD release and possibly television broadcast. We were asked to use F900s because the company wanted the best quality HDCAM images possible. And of course, shooting in HDCAM increases the opportunity for international sales. After speaking to HD expert Paul Wheeler, we opted to shoot in 50i, the interlaced setting used for television broadcast in the UK and Europe (PAL). Paul suggested this to get more of a live look than using a progressive scan setting (film look) would achieve. (A previous E-Zine covered the difference between the progressive scan and interlace settings). Downconverters Using the F900 meant having to put downconverters on the back of every camera. This is because the F900 only has a component HDCAM output. To effectively direct the shoot I needed to watch the images from all six cameras at a basic gallery we set up backstage. Using the camera’s component (RGB) output would require running three cables from each camera to our backstage monitoring set-up much more of a hassle and cost than running a single BNC from each downconverter using the HD SDI output. Also, the camera operators needed to use the camera’s HD component output to feed the 7-inch HD LCD monitors we mounted on their camcorder handles so they didn’t have to stare into the viewfinder for 90 minutes solid to monitor their shots. Our engineer concluded that downconverters, particularly older models, are often not to be trusted for judging the sharpness of the focus and the exposures. You have to be very careful. We have some brand new Miranda downconverters and they were fine when you used the HD SDI output. On the engineering bench at our premises, we discovered that when using the SD (standard definition) SDI output the results are best when the camera is set to 24P. Otherwise, the image tends to be soft and the exposure you see on the monitor is not the same as that on the recorded image. The best signal came from the HD component outputs on the camera itself. HD BNC Cables A couple of comments here. First, if you’re using an HD SDI output and you need to run more than ten metres of cable you need to use BNC cables that are made to carry HDCAM signals. These cables are thicker and capable of carrying more information. A standard BNC cable just can’t handle carrying the signal over more than several metres and you won’t see anything on the monitoring end. Second, one of our HDCAM cables was about ten metres shorter than we needed. We tried using a barrel to join two HD BNC cables and it didn’t do the job. So we had to use the SD (standard definition) composite video output on the downconverter which, as explained above, is not ideal. To get around the problem of looking at images that appeared to be soft and overexposed, I kept checking with the camera operator using the comms system to make sure he considered the image sharp. As for the exposures, our engineer looked at the images through an HD wave form monitor to confirm they were good. HD LCD Monitors In our backstage gallery we used two models of monitors discussed in an earlier E-Zine: the Panasonic BT-LH1700WE 17-inch LCD monitor and the Sony LMD-9050 LCD monitor. This was the first time I had personally worked with them. Both are HD monitors and both are excellent. Using these new monitors has eliminated previous concerns I had about LCD monitors not being able to deliver the same quality of image as CRT (cathode ray tube) monitors. The colours were true, the images sharp and the brightness and contrast were consistent no matter which angle you were viewing the monitors from. They are also light and take up less space. And let’s not forget, they’re environmentally friendlier. Summary To sum up, if you’re using the F900 for a multi-camera job, use the latest model of downconverter, use HD compatible BNC cable for longer runs and by all means use the new models of HD LCD monitors. The age of high definition video cameras and LCD TV
Everyone desires to capture the interesting, unique and memorable events of the life. This is being achieved with the cameras for a long time now. From the times when the cameras used to click the black and white photos to the time when these are clicking the coloured high resolution photos, cameras have definitely travelled a long technological distance. And, it is not just the snap shots but also the full high definition video recordings which the modern day video cameras, or call them camcorders are capable of doing. The high definition quality is achieved at 2-3 mega pixel resolutions of the cameras and most of the high LCD TV or monitors may not be supporting more than this resolution. So, you do not actually need more than 3 MP video cameras for ‘high definition’ shooting and viewing of the videos. It is the resolution which makes a display or recording device of high-definition calibre. A full HD is achieved at the resolution levels of 1920×1080 pixels. Therefore, having a video or image captured on the DVD does not make it HD in nature. It only makes it optical in nature. When you are looking the find a HD camera from a reputed manufacturer like Panasonic, you must see 720i or 1080p or HD etched on it. There are two HD variants currently available. One is the HDV which takes the images in the 1440 pixel resolution but it stretches the video to 1920 pixels level. Therefore, these have to be compressed using the well known MPEG-2 video compression technology. The HDV is the old format. The new one is the AVCHD, or the advanced video codec high definition, which makes use of even more advanced compression technology called MPEG-4 that creates even smaller files in the compressed format. Editing these compressed files is not easy. You are required to have a compatible video editing program for this purpose of taking care of the editing of the AVCHD files. High Definition TV Resolutions: The Basics
What makes High Definition TV so great? Most HDTV watchers would tell you that it’s simple: higher resolution. That’s what sets HDTV apart from regular TV. Regular television, or “standard definition” as it’s also called, shows up to 480 pixels per line. It looks good if you’ve never experienced HDTV’s higher resolution. With HDTV, the resolution depends on the source. There are two main source resolutions used in HDTV: 1080i and 720p. 1080i 1080i has a resolution of 1,920 by 1,080 pixels. This is a major improvement over standard definition television. CBS, NBC, Discovery Channel’s HD broadcasts, PBS and the Xbox 360 all use this resolution. Of course, you can watch these stations on a lower resolution TV set, but if you have a 1080i set, you’ll get the better resolution. Also, 1080i is in a widescreen format. This is another great feature of HDTV. 720p 720p has a lower resolution. It’s 1,280 by 720 pixels. Even though it has a lower resolution than 1080i, the difference is not as noticeable as the difference between either one and a standard definition TV. 720p also has the widescreen format. ABC, Fox and ESPN’s HD broadcasts all use this resolution. 720p’s resolution is lower, but it has a feature called “progressive scan” that 1080i doesn’t. Progressive scan makes the movement on screen more fluid and realistic. Progressive scan makes the image move more smoothly. 480p There is also a 480p format, which Fox uses for its digital broadcasts, but it’s technically not HDTV, although it can be viewed on HDTV’s. It’s 852 by 480 pixels, widescreen and has progressive scan. Fox is the only network that uses this resolution, but some DVD players use it because of the smoother movement of progressive scan. 1080p There is a newer format called 1080p which has the high resolution of the 1080i with the progressive scan of the 720p, but no network uses it yet. It’s mostly a resolution format that some HDTV’s are made in. According to reviews, 1080p isn’t very much different than 1080i. Unless you have a large TV, like something over 46 inches, there’s no noticeable difference. The 1080p might be good for serious HDTV nuts. It does enable manufacturers to add special features, like increased contrast or better color. Unless you have a really good eye, you might not notice these differences, though. And, the 1080p sets usually cost quite a bit more than the others. In the next few years, there will probably be more reasonably priced 1080p sets. It’s expected that more networks will begin taking advantage of 1080p’s resolution and possibilities and begin broadcasting in 1080p. If this happens, 1080p sets may become a better buy.
